Abstract
The Stanley chromatic symmetric function of a graph is a symmetric function generalization of the chromatic polynomial, and has interesting combinatorial properties. We apply the ideas of Khovanov homology to construct a homology of graded -modules, whose graded Frobenius series reduces to the chromatic symmetric function at . This homology can be thought of as a categorification of the chromatic symmetric function, and provides a homological analogue of several familiar properties of . In particular, the decomposition formula for discovered recently by Orellana and Scott, and Guay-Paquet is lifted to a long exact sequence in homology.
